Comments
Loading...

Meta Materials

MMATQOTCPK
Logo brought to you by Benzinga Data
$0.528250
-0.09-14.80%
At Close: -
15 minutes delayed

Latest news for Meta Materials (OTC:MMATQ) Stock

Meta Materials Stock (OTC: MMATQ)

There are no results